Oracle用户权限管理与数据库体系结构详解
需积分: 50 147 浏览量
更新于2024-08-15
收藏 368KB PPT 举报
本文主要介绍了Oracle数据库系统的用户系统权限管理和其基本体系结构。在Oracle中,权限管理通过角色和系统权限授予与回收命令实现,同时提到了密码过期策略。Oracle数据库是一个重要的数据存储和管理工具,具有丰富的历史和发展历程。
在Oracle数据库中,用户系统权限管理是一个关键的安全特性。角色是一组相关的权限集合,允许管理员通过一次性操作为多个用户或角色分配权限,从而简化权限管理。例如,可以使用`GRANT`命令将`CREATE ANY TABLE`系统权限授予名为`ICD`的用户或角色,命令格式为`GRANT CREATE ANY TABLE TO ICD;`。当需要收回权限时,使用`REVOKE`命令,如`REVOKE CREATE ANY TABLE FROM ICD;`,这可以有效地回收指定用户的权限。
Oracle数据库的体系结构包括了多个组件,这些组件共同协作以处理数据和确保系统运行。核心组件之一是实例(Instance),由System Global Area (SGA)组成,这是一个共享内存区域,包含了数据库的各种缓存,如数据缓冲区缓存(用于存储数据块)、共享池(存储PL/SQL代码和SQL解析信息)以及数据字典缓存等。此外,还有后台进程,如DBWR(数据库写入进程)负责将数据缓冲区中的更改写入数据文件,SMON(系统监控)进行系统级别的恢复操作,LGWR(日志写入进程)处理重做日志文件的写入,PMON(进程监控)负责清理失败的进程等。
Oracle数据库的历史可以追溯到1977年,自那时起,它经历了多次重大版本更新,从Oracle6到Oracle10g,每个版本都带来了性能和功能的提升。Oracle数据库不仅是一个数据库管理系统,也是网络计算的倡导者,提供了一种在分布式环境中高效处理数据的解决方案。
用户进程和服务器进程是数据库交互的关键部分。用户进程是客户端应用程序,它们连接到数据库实例,并通过服务器进程来执行SQL语句和处理结果。服务器进程可以是专用服务器进程(为单个用户服务)或共享服务器进程(为多个用户服务),取决于数据库的配置。
Oracle数据库通过其精细的权限管理和强大的体系结构,为各种规模的企业提供了可靠且灵活的数据管理平台。理解这些概念对于有效管理Oracle数据库系统至关重要。
2009-07-02 上传
2010-08-10 上传
2021-09-22 上传
2014-12-16 上传
2011-10-16 上传
点击了解资源详情
点击了解资源详情
2007-08-29 上传
2007-07-10 上传
VayneYin
- 粉丝: 23
- 资源: 2万+
最新资源
- ES管理利器:ES Head工具详解
- Layui前端UI框架压缩包:轻量级的Web界面构建利器
- WPF 字体布局问题解决方法与应用案例
- 响应式网页布局教程:CSS实现全平台适配
- Windows平台Elasticsearch 8.10.2版发布
- ICEY开源小程序:定时显示极限值提醒
- MATLAB条形图绘制指南:从入门到进阶技巧全解析
- WPF实现任务管理器进程分组逻辑教程解析
- C#编程实现显卡硬件信息的获取方法
- 前端世界核心-HTML+CSS+JS团队服务网页模板开发
- 精选SQL面试题大汇总
- Nacos Server 1.2.1在Linux系统的安装包介绍
- 易语言MySQL支持库3.0#0版全新升级与使用指南
- 快乐足球响应式网页模板:前端开发全技能秘籍
- OpenEuler4.19内核发布:国产操作系统的里程碑
- Boyue Zheng的LeetCode Python解答集